Advertisement
Continue Reading Below
Properties Nearby
| Street Address |
|---|
2308 Hibiscus Ave, Seffner, FL 33584-4357 Single Family
|
2312 Hibiscus Ave, Seffner, FL 33584-4357 Single Family Residential
|
2314 Hibiscus Ave, Seffner, FL 33584-4357 Single Family Residential
|
2318 Hibiscus Ave, Seffner, FL 33584-4357 Single Family Residential
|
2324 Hibiscus Ave, Seffner, FL 33584-4357 Single Family Residential
|